—Derwentwater Ten.

This has to be one of the country’s most beautiful road races . From Keswick you do a lap of Derwentwater, marvelling  at the wondrous autumnal colours displayed on the  mountain sides  and reflecting off the still lake .
This race is a hidden gem that you can enter on the day , it’s not even very hilly as it’s mostly around the lake.

—Saltersgate Gallows

A relatively gentle  8 mile fell race , taking in the sights of the North Yorkshire Moors Railway , Skelton Tower, Saltersgate Bank, the Hole of Horcum and the old Roman Road back to Levisham.
